引言
在现代互联网中,*VPN(虚拟私人网络)*已经成为保护个人隐私和安全的重要工具。无论是在公共Wi-Fi环境下上网,还是希望访问被限制的网站,搭建一个个人VPN都是一个有效的解决方案。本文将为您提供详细的步骤和注意事项,让您能够顺利地搭建自己的VPN。
什么是VPN?
*VPN(Virtual Private Network)*是一种技术,它可以在公共网络上建立一个安全的私密通道。通过这个通道,用户可以加密他们的数据,并隐匿他们的真实IP地址,从而增强网络安全性和隐私保护。
为什么选择个人搭建VPN?
个人搭建VPN有以下几个优点:
- 安全性高:自己搭建的VPN,您可以完全控制数据传输的安全性。
- 灵活性:可以根据需要自由配置VPN参数。
- 成本低:虽然搭建过程可能需要一些技术知识,但长期来说,可以节省租用VPN服务的费用。
- 隐私保护:避免使用公共VPN服务带来的隐私风险。
选择VPN类型
在搭建VPN之前,您需要选择合适的VPN类型。常见的VPN类型包括:
- PPTP:速度快,但安全性相对较低。
- L2TP/IPsec:比PPTP安全,但配置复杂。
- OpenVPN:开源、灵活且安全性高,是推荐的选择。
- WireGuard:新兴协议,速度快,安全性好。
搭建VPN所需工具
搭建个人VPN所需的工具包括:
- 一台具有公网IP的服务器(可以选择VPS提供商,如DigitalOcean、Linode等)
- SSH工具(如PuTTY)
- VPN软件(如OpenVPN、WireGuard等)
- 必要的系统知识
个人搭建VPN的详细步骤
1. 选择VPS服务商
选择一家可靠的VPS服务商,注册并创建服务器。推荐选择数据中心靠近您物理位置的服务器。
2. 连接到服务器
使用SSH工具连接到您的VPS。
ssh root@your-server-ip
3. 更新系统
连接后,确保您的系统是最新的:
apt update && apt upgrade -y
4. 安装OpenVPN
在服务器上安装OpenVPN:
apt install openvpn easy-rsa -y
5. 配置OpenVPN
- 复制配置文件到适当的目录:
make-cadir /etc/openvpn/easy-rsa cd /etc/openvpn/easy-rsa
- 生成密钥和证书。
6. 启动OpenVPN服务
启动OpenVPN服务,确保它能自动开机:
systemctl start openvpn@server systemctl enable openvpn@server
7. 配置客户端
在客户端上安装OpenVPN并配置连接。
常见问题解答(FAQ)
如何选择合适的VPS服务商?
选择VPS服务商时,应考虑以下因素:
- 服务器的性能(CPU、内存、带宽)
- 服务器的稳定性和可靠性
- 客服支持的质量
- 价格
搭建VPN的过程复杂吗?
搭建VPN的过程需要一定的技术知识,尤其是在服务器配置和网络设置方面。但根据本指南进行,基本步骤较为明确,适合有一定基础的用户尝试。
使用VPN有哪些法律风险?
在某些国家/地区,使用VPN可能会违反当地法律。建议您在使用VPN之前,了解并遵循当地的法律法规。
如何确保VPN的安全性?
确保使用最新的加密协议和技术,定期更新您的VPN软件,以及使用强密码来保护VPN账户。
结论
个人搭建VPN是保护个人隐私和数据安全的有效方法。通过本指南,您应该能够顺利完成VPN的搭建。希望您能享受安全、私密的上网体验!